The LBX Show #35 - Inside Bowl Expo 2025: Trends and Industry Shifts
Description
Sponsored by Intercard!
On this week's show, Brandon is joined by Kevin Williams and Adam Pratt for a special Guest Gab review of the Bowl Expo 2025 experience, examining the state of the bowling industry and the growing influence of competitive socializing on traditional bowling centers. The future of bowling centers depends on embracing tech innovations and diversified entertainment offerings beyond just lanes.
• Bowl Expo 2025 suffered from lower attendance due to its scheduling just before July 4th holiday
• Tradeshow layout revealed many empty spaces with most vendors downsizing to minimal booth sizes
• Notable absence of complementary attractions like billiards tables despite their natural pairing with bowling
• New social entertainment offerings included Puttify (tech-infused mini-golf) and Singa (drop-in karaoke solution)
• Bowling industry faces a growing divide between traditional centers and boutique/social entertainment venues
• Industry insiders suggest future shows need better timing and more compelling reasons for vendors to participate
• Technology integration becoming essential for bowling centers to attract and retain modern customers
• Multi-location security solutions from companies like Intercard increasingly important for operational stability
• Growing trend of bowling centers converting underutilized spaces into additional revenue streams
• Successful venues now focusing as much on food, beverage and atmosphere as they do on bowling itself
